What is Vitamin C Serum with Ascorbic Acid?
Vitamin C Serum with Ascorbic Acid is a topical skincare product that typically contains a high concentration of Ascorbic Acid, a potent form of Vitamin C. Ascorbic Acid is revered for its antioxidant properties, which help to neutralise free radicals and prevent oxidative stress in the skin. When applied consistently, this serum can enhance the overall appearance of your skin, making it look more youthful and radiant.
Benefits of Vitamin C Serum with Ascorbic Acid
One of the primary benefits of using Vitamin C Serum with Ascorbic Acid is its ability to brighten the skin. This serum can help to fade hyperpigmentation, reduce dark spots, and give your complexion a more even tone. Additionally, Ascorbic Acid stimulates collagen production, which is essential for maintaining skin elasticity and reducing the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les.
Furthermore, Vitamin C Serum with Ascorbic Acid offers excellent protection against photodamage. By shielding the skin from harmful UV rays and other environmental stressors, it helps to prevent premature ageing and maintains the skin's natural barrier. This protective quality makes it an ideal component in any anti-ageing skincare regimen.
How to Use Vitamin C Serum with Ascorbic Acid
For optimal results, it is important to apply Vitamin C Serum with Ascorbic Acid correctly. Start by cleansing your face thoroughly to remove any impurities. Following your cleanse, gently pat your skin dry with a clean towel. Apply a few drops of the serum onto your fingertips and gently massage it into your face and neck, avoiding the eye area. Allow the serum to absorb fully before applying moisturiser and sunscreen.
It is recommended to use Vitamin C Serum with Ascorbic Acid in the morning as part of your daytime skincare routine. This maximises its photoprotective benefits. However, some individuals may prefer to use it at night due to its potent nature.
Choosing the Right Vitamin C Serum with Ascorbic Acid
When selecting a Vitamin C Serum with Ascorbic Acid, it is crucial to consider the product's formulation and concentration. Look for serums that contain a stable form of Ascorbic Acid at a concentration of 10-20%. Furthermore, the serum should be packaged in a dark, airtight container to prevent oxidation and ensure its efficacy.
Many reputable skincare brands offer Vitamin C Serum with Ascorbic Acid, and it is worth considering reviews and recommendations from skincare professionals. Additionally, individuals with sensitive skin may benefit from starting with a lower concentration to minimise the risk of irritation.
